Matthew Schmahl is a History student at the University of California, Irvine. Sometimes he gets bored and makes bad synth-pop music. Eventually, he made enough of it to fill an album, which he compiled and handed out to friends and family. Frequent themes in his music include unrequited love and his recurring insomnia.
